Business Studies: A
Comprehensive
Overview
Business studies encompasses a wide range of disciplines that provide a
comprehensive understanding of business operations, management, and
economic principles. It equips individuals with the knowledge and skills
necessary to succeed in the dynamic world of business.

Entrepreneurship and Innovation
Idea Generation Identifying opportunities and developing
innovative solutions.
Business Planning Creating a detailed roadmap for launching and
growing a new business.
Funding and Financing Securing financial resources to support the
venture.
Marketing and Sales Promoting the business and generating revenue.
